摘要

This paper discusses planning, implementation, performance monitoring, and results of restoration at the 441-hectare Bunker Hill Hillsides Site in northern Idaho. A series of three workshops in 1998 and 1999 were initially convened to develop remediation guidance statements. Concurrent with planning, two years of intense site characterization and alternative treatment testing was conducted. Implementation has largely relied on hydro-application of restoration materials using Sikorski S-64 helicopters. Initial restoration efforts focused on establishing an early successional plant community. Additional woody vegetation was established in islands across the site. The Hillsides Site is now covered in native herbaceous vegetation, previously planted trees have responded favorably to the applied amendments, and four new native woody and seven native herbaceous volunteer species are colonizing the site. Natural regeneration is common and initiation of ecological processes, such as nutrient recycling is evident. Erosion and contaminated sediment transport from the hillsides has subsided as vegetation cover has increased. Results of the 2005 monitoring season are discussed.
